Subject: Ownership change — parcel-tracking webhook

Team, ahead of Thursday's sync: responsibility for the Cartwheel parcel-tracking webhook is moving off my plate as I shift to the routing project. The webhook handles carrier status callbacks and retries; runbooks are up to date in the Cartwheel wiki. Alerting thresholds were retuned last sprint, so expect fewer pages. Effective Monday, all escalations, reviews, and pager duty for this service transfer to the engineer named below.

named custodian: Brivan Eliath Quenox Frador

# Break-Glass: Catalog Cache Invalidation

Scope: the Pinrow product catalog at Veldstone Retail. If stale prices persist after a purge and the Hollowmere invalidation queue is wedged, use break-glass to flush the edge tier directly. Contractors: get verbal sign-off from the catalog lead first. Steps: open the Hollowmere admin shell, select emergency-flush, confirm the tenant, and run it once — repeated flushes thrash the origin. Access is logged and expires after 20 minutes. Unseal the admin shell with the passphrase below.

recovery phrase for kahop-tajog: istix-casvan

UserSplit Cutover Drift: the extracted account service and the legacy Marigold monolith user module are reporting divergent record counts during dual-write. This fires when drift exceeds 0.5% over 15 minutes. New team members should not replay writes manually. Reconciliation steps and the rollback procedure are documented on the internal page.

wiki page, tajog-fafog: https://gitlab.paliqsys.corp/dash/display/job/853dd6fcbf54

## Formula Sandbox — Onboarding Notes

User-supplied formulas in Calcine run inside the Hermit sandbox: no network, 250ms CPU budget, 64MB memory cap. If the sandbox pool is exhausted you'll see queue-depth alerts; scale the pool via the Hermit dashboard rather than raising limits per tenant. Escape attempts are logged and auto-quarantined. Never disable the syscall filter, even for debugging. For quarantine reviews, contact the sandbox security rotation at the address below.

escalation mailbox, hadug-bajog: sormir@norvalabs.internal